        Bijan Robinson To Get Christian McCaffrey-Type Usage?

        By Jared Smola | Updated on Sun, Jul 14 2024 1:03 AM UTC
        Bijan Robinson Headshot

        Falcons OC Zac Robinson said he'll find "creative ways" to get the ball to RB Bijan Robinson, drawing a comparison to how the 49ers use RB Christian McCaffrey. Zac Robinson never coached McCaffrey -- but he did spend the last five seasons working under Rams HC Sean McVay, whose offense has regularly produced big RB numbers.

        What They're Saying

        Here's the full quote from Falcons OC Zac Robinson on his plans for RB Bijan Robinson:

        “He’s going to play running back first and foremost and then any way we can find creative ways to get him the ball like the Niners do with Christian McCaffrey is exactly right. Continuing to tailor and tweak things and find creative ways to get him the football and not just in the dot or in the offset gun running the football, but using his receiver skills without overloading him too much. (There’s) always going to be the balance of it. Hey, you’re playing running back, but here are some of the specific nuances that we get you involved in the pass game.”

        2024 Fantasy Football Impact

        You don't need us to tell you that this is exciting news for Robinson's 2024 fantasy outlook. His usage under former HC Arthur Smith last year was often frustrating. Robinson ranked 14th among RBs in expected PPR points per game.

        That ranking figures to climb significantly in 2024, potentially even to No. 1. And if that comes to fruition, Robinson would have the potential to lead RBs in fantasy points.

        He's fairly valued at his mid-Round-1 ADP.

        Other Winners & Losers

        More work for Robinson would be bad news for RB Tyler Allgeier, who ranked 47th in expected PPR points per game last year. We're not expecting him to be useable in fantasy lineups as long as Robinson is healthy this season. Allgeier is still worth a bench stash, though, as a strong handcuff to Robinson.
